After a year long hiatus, I'm officially back to work.  I have to admit that I'm just a little nervous.  I've moved more than 2,000 miles from my client base, purchased a new home, and now I'm facing the monumental task of starting all over again. 

 

When I left California I had a solid client base.  My SOI was 100% responsible for generating business.  I hadn't advertised or solicited business from strangers for an entire year.  Now, I'm starting from scratch in a new market with a very small SOI. 

 

The more I think about it, the more I realize that this is a great opportunity!  I'm relearning all of the basics that we, as seasoned agents, tend to forget over time.  We get so busy that we fall into a routine and forget to keep learning.  I suddenly have a new found enthusiasm for learning again!  I'm soaking up advertising and marketing ideas like a giant sponge and my mind is constantly running.  I wake up in the middle of the night to jot down ideas in my notebook.  What an opportunity for me!  What an opportunity for my clients!

 

Maybe we should all start over every few years.  Break the mold!  Learn something new!  Take the time to remember what it was like to be a newly licensed agent full of hope and possibility!
